Abstract
Purpose
Organisations are investing in systems such as product lifecycle management (PLM) to support product development, collaboration across complex supply chains and to provide a framework for digital transformation. Graduates of apparel programmes would benefit from a knowledge of PLM to help realise the opportunities that PLM offers. The purpose of this paper is to report on an educational research project that used PLM as a context for practice-based learning and as a mechanism to update the learning experience and stimulate the development of future practice.
Design/methodology/approach
This paper reports on the experiences, critical reflections and data from an action research study to establish a learning community through an educational partnership for PLM software within an undergraduate fashion business course. The cohort of the first year of the intervention (n = 28) is the main study population.
Findings
The findings indicate that PLM provided a stimulating learning context supportive of a detailed understanding of current industry practice, critical and innovative thinking and the development of a professional identity.
Research limitations/implications
The opportunity for the development of both industry and educational practice is outlined.
Practical implications
A general introduction to PLM provides important information to support and advance Fashion Industry 4.0. Educational partnerships can reduce barriers to the integration of advanced technologies into the higher education curriculum.
Originality/value
Applications of PLM are under researched in textiles and apparel. The paper contributes to the broadening of the knowledge base of PLM and its potential to achieve strategic transformation of the sector.

Patient length of stay (LOS) is an important indicator of emergency department (ED) performance. Investigating factors that influence LOS could thus improve healthcare delivery…
Abstract
Purpose
Patient length of stay (LOS) is an important indicator of emergency department (ED) performance. Investigating factors that influence LOS could thus improve healthcare delivery and patient safety. Previous studies have focused on patient-level factors to explain LOS variation, with little research into service-related factors. This study examined the association between LOS and multi-level factors including patient-, service- and organization-level factors.
Design/methodology/approach
This study uses a retrospective observational design to identify a cohort of patients from arrival to discharge from ED. A year-long data regarding patients flow trhoguh ED were analyzed using analytics techniques and multi-regression models. The response variable was patient LOS, and the independent variables were patient characteristics, service-related factors and organizational variables.
Findings
The findings of this study showed that older patients, middle triage and hospitalization were all associated with longer LOS. Service-related factors such as complexity of care provided, initial ward designation and ward transfer had a significant impact as well. Finally, prolonged LOS was associated with a higher ratio of patients per medical doctor and per nurse. In contrast, a higher number of residents in the ED were associated with longer patient LOS.
Originality/value
Previous studies on patient LOS have focused on patient-level factors, with little research on service-related factors. This study has addressed that gap by examining the association between LOS and multi-level factors including patient-, service- and organization-level factors. Patient-level factors included demographics, acuity, arrival shift, arrival mode and discharge type. Service-level factors consisted of first ward, ward transfer and complexity of care provided. Organizational factors consisted of three ratios: patients per MD, patients per nurse and patients per resident. The results add to the current understanding of factors that increase patient LOS in EDs and contribute to the body of knowledge on ED performance, operation management and quality of care. The study also provides practical and managerial insights that could be used to improve patient flow in EDs and reduce LOS.

This study aims to understand the impact of the Covid-19 pandemic disruptive event on delivery of the built environment degree apprentice programme in higher education in the UK…
Abstract
Purpose
This study aims to understand the impact of the Covid-19 pandemic disruptive event on delivery of the built environment degree apprentice programme in higher education in the UK and identify the key strategies to minimise the effect.
Design/methodology/approach
A qualitative approach was used to collect and analyse data from a sample set of built environment degree apprenticeship stakeholders. Semi-structured interviews were conducted with 17 key stakeholders to collate emerging themes on their perceptions of the impacts of the pandemic and strategies to adopted to minimise it.
Findings
The investigation reveals that the core impacts of Covid-19 on the apprentices training programme are lack of access to the site, furlough, limited access to off the job training, limited interaction with tutors and peers, too much time on the screen, limited pastoral care and lack of contact with a mentor. The census from the research participants is that despite the development and gain with the various virtual platform used during pandemic physical meetings with their mentor remain pivotal to the built environment apprentices learning and training.
Practical implications
The results provide relevant stakeholders and actors supporting degree apprentices training programmes (training providers and employers, among others) with the information needed to improve the delivery of built environment degree apprenticeship training programmes during a disruptive event Covid-19. The study identifies various strategies to minimise the impact of disruptive events on the apprentices training, including technology, regular meeting with mentors online, and personal and pastoral care.
Originality/value
The study is the first to document the impact of the Covid-19 pandemic on degree apprenticeship programs in the built environment. This study provides an in-depth understanding of how these programs have been affected and offers potential solutions to reduce or mitigate potential damage. The research will inform future policy decisions related to degree apprenticeship programs in the built environment.

This study explores the critical success factors (CSFs) for Security Education, Training and Awareness (SETA) program effectiveness. The questionable effectiveness of SETA…
Abstract
Purpose
This study explores the critical success factors (CSFs) for Security Education, Training and Awareness (SETA) program effectiveness. The questionable effectiveness of SETA programs at changing employee behavior and an absence of empirical studies on the CSFs for SETA program effectiveness is the key motivation for this study.
Design/methodology/approach
This exploratory study follows a systematic inductive approach to concept development. The methodology adopts the “key informant” approach to give voice to practitioners with SETA program expertise. Data are gathered using semi-structured interviews with 20 key informants from various geographic locations including the Gulf nations, Middle East, USA, UK and Ireland.
Findings
In this study, the analysis of these key informant interviews, following an inductive open, axial and selective coding approach, produces 11 CSFs for SETA program effectiveness. These CSFs are mapped along the phases of a SETA program lifecycle (design, development, implementation and evaluation) and nine relationships identified between the CSFs (within and across the lifecycle phases) are highlighted. The CSFs and CSFs' relationships are visualized in a Lifecycle Model of CSFs for SETA program effectiveness.
Originality/value
This research advances the first comprehensive conceptualization of the CSFs for SETA program effectiveness. The Lifecycle Model of CSFs for SETA program effectiveness provides valuable insights into the process of introducing and sustaining an effective SETA program in practice. The Lifecycle Model contributes to both theory and practice and lays the foundation for future studies.

Cyber security has never been more important than it is today in an ever more connected and pervasive digital world. However, frequently reported shortages of suitably skilled and…
Abstract
Purpose
Cyber security has never been more important than it is today in an ever more connected and pervasive digital world. However, frequently reported shortages of suitably skilled and trained information system (IS)/cyber security professionals elevate the importance of delivering effective Security Education,Training and Awareness (SETA) programmes within organisations. Therefore, the purpose of this study is the questionable effectiveness of SETA programmes at changing employee behaviour and an absence of empirical studies on the critical success factors (CSFs) for SETA programme effectiveness.
Design/methodology/approach
This exploratory study follows a three-stage research design to give voice to practitioners with SETA programme expertise. Data is gathered in Stage 1 using semi-structured interviews with 20 key informants (the emergence of the CSFs), in Stage 2 from 65 respondents to a short online survey (the ranking of the CSFs) and in Stage 3 using semi-structured interviews with nine IS/cyber security practitioners (the emergence of the guiding principles). Using a multi-stage research design allows the authors to propose and evaluate the 11 CSFs for SETA programme effectiveness.
Findings
This study conducted a mean score analysis to evaluate the level of importance of each CSF within two independent groups of IS/cyber security professionals. This multi-stage analysis produces a ranked list of 11 CSFs for SETA programme effectiveness, while the difference in the rankings leads to the emergence of five CSF-specific guiding principles (to increase the likelihood of delivering an effective SETA programme within an organisational context). This analysis also reveals that most of the contradictions/differences in CSF rankings between IS/cyber security practitioners are linked to the design phase of the SETA programme life cycle. While two CSFs, “maintain quarterly evaluation of employee performance” (CSF-DS6) and “build security awareness campaigns” (CSF-EV1), represent the most significant contradiction in this study.
Originality/value
The 11 CSFs for SETA programme effectiveness, along with the five CSF-specific guiding principles, provide a greater depth of knowledge contributing to both theory and practice and lays the foundation for future studies. Therefore, the outputs of this study provide valuable insights on the areas that practice needs to get right to deliver effective SETA programmes.
